Product details

It delivers one 3 A channel and two 2 A channels from a single 4.5 V to 18 V input rail, with all three outputs adjustable down to 0.6 V. The synchronous rectifier is integrated, so no external Schottky catch diode is needed.

What the 3 A / 2 A rating means for your BOM

The 3 A output is the primary rail — typically the core or I/O supply — while the two 2 A outputs handle auxiliary loads like PLL, memory, or peripheral buses. The 0.6 V minimum output lets it feed modern low-voltage cores without an extra LDO.

Package and rework — the QFN reality

Reflow profile should follow the JEDEC standard for QFN; the exposed pad needs a good solder joint for both thermal and electrical connection to the ground plane.

What is the switching frequency range of TPS65261-1RHBT?

The switching frequency is adjustable from 250 kHz to 2 MHz. Lower frequencies improve efficiency but require larger inductors; higher frequencies shrink the magnetics at the cost of increased switching losses.
